What the document actually says

The plan is a nine-ministry product, with the Ministry of Industry and Information Technology at the point. BeInCrypto's coverage is thin-sourced — multiple "no source" annotations, a crypto-native outlet parsing industrial policy it structurally isn't built to parse. So the numbers need to be pulled out and read cold.

The hard targets:

  • 2030: NEVs at 70% of new passenger vehicle sales.
  • 2030: NEVs at 40% of new commercial vehicle sales.
  • Passenger fleet fuel economy: 3.3L/100km.
  • Pure-electric consumption: roughly 11.5kWh/100km.
  • First-ever capacity warning and control clause written into an auto industry plan.
  • Explicit mandate to push mergers and cross-province integration.
  • Global KPI targets: several Chinese automakers inside the global top ten by volume; Chinese parts suppliers inside the global top hundred.

The 11.5 kWh number nobody priced

The efficiency targets deserve more attention than the autonomy headline, because they quietly kill a whole technological road.

An 11.5kWh/100km target for a pure-electric vehicle is one of the most aggressive fleet-average numbers any major market has published. For context, a Tesla Model 3 in real European driving logs 13–14kWh/100km. So the plan is asking Chinese OEMs to beat current best-in-class by 15–20% at fleet scale.

You cannot hit that number by stacking more cells into a pack. You hit it through system efficiency — lighter bodies, better thermal management, higher-voltage drivetrains, and pack-level structural redesign. That reframes the competition from energy density to Wh/km, and it's a structural tailwind for LFP chemistry, which wins through CTP and CTB pack innovation rather than fighting for high-nickel energy density it will never match on a cell-to-cell basis.

LFP already crossed 70% of China's installed battery capacity in 2024, with cell costs down toward 0.3–0.4 RMB/Wh. The policy just pushed the whole industry further down that road without saying the word "LFP" once.

Here's the tell that nobody flagged. The document is silent on solid-state timing. For a plan that wants large-scale Level 4 autonomy by 2030 — high compute, high-reliability redundant power, brutal cycle-life requirements on the pack — the omission is loud. It means the center won't underwrite a battery timeline it can't control. It watched hydrogen over-promise in the last decade and learned. Same protocol, different vertical: the center doesn't negotiate on technology it can't deliver. It executes the neutral option or it fails.

The hidden mechanism here is that efficiency targets replace range targets. Early policy waved a 500km/600km range banner over the industry and got inflated range claims and oversized packs in return. Switching to kWh/100km is a discipline tool. It raises the value of drivetrain, thermal, and lightweighting suppliers and quietly devalues any model whose only selling point was a big battery bag.

The signal: capacity utilization at 70%

Auto sector capacity utilization in China fell to roughly 70% in the first quarter. The healthy line is 80%. Below 75% is where industries get cleared. This is not a soft data point — it's the classic precondition for policy-driven consolidation, and China has run this playbook before, twice, at national scale.

In 2016, the steel and coal sectors were dragged through supply-side reform: forced capacity cuts, consolidation onto a handful of survivors, and a policy that treated overcapacity as a national liability rather than a local GDP line. Years later, that same logic gets pointed at anything with too many producers and not enough margin.

Map it onto crypto and you've already lived through the identical curve. Exchanges in 2017 numbered in the hundreds; the survivors are under twenty. Miners in 2021 were a long tail of retail rigs; after the halving and the hash-rate reset, the network consolidated onto a handful of industrial farms. DeFi Summer spawned thousands of fork protocols; each drawdown cleared the ones that couldn't fund their own liquidity.

The lifecycle is not a crypto quirk. It's a market invariant. Cars, tokens, hash power — the asset doesn't matter. What matters is whether capacity grew faster than demand, and China just told the world, in writing, that its auto capacity grew faster than demand.

The first-ever capacity-warning clause does two things at once. It signals the state will absorb the political cost of plant closures. And, less obviously, it recentralizes approval authority — for a decade, local governments waved through factory permits to chase GDP and employment. A central capacity warning is a brake pedal the provinces won't press themselves.

The cross-province integration mandate is the sharper instrument. Merging a coastal survivor with an inland plant means crossing exactly the jurisdiction that protects it. China doesn't put "cross-province" into a plan by accident. It puts it in when the center has decided local protectionism costs more than it returns. When the center moves, the provinces negotiate — and the tail gets sold.

The 60% option: hydrogen's reserved territory

The commercial-vehicle target hides the smartest line in the document. NEVs at 40% of new commercial sales leaves 60% of that market — the long-haul heavy trucks, the hardest electrification use case there is — undecided.

Fuel-cell trucks and pure-electric trucks will fight for that remainder, and the policy has deliberately left the field open. If green hydrogen gets cheap enough, that 40% gets revised up. If battery-electric heavy trucks break through on range and charging, they eat the rest. It's an option, not a target. Green hydrogen still runs roughly 20–40 RMB/kg against diesel-equivalent economics, which puts large-scale substitution out to 2027–2030 at the earliest. So the plan keeps the door open and refuses to pick a winner.

That's the same discipline the efficiency target showed on solid-state. Don't underwrite a timeline you can't control. Keep the option alive.

Underneath this sits the charging-versus-swap argument that the crypto coverage didn't touch at all. Fleet autonomy changes the math. A robotaxi that drives itself to a swap station and exchanges a pack in three minutes is a fundamentally different operating cost than one that sits on a 15–30 minute supercharge. For commercial fleets, swap has the better coupling to autonomy. For private cars, 800V high-voltage supercharging remains the default. The unspoken prerequisite is pack standardization — without it, swap stations can't amortize their heavy per-site capex, and the whole model stalls.

The plan doesn't mention any of this. Sometimes a silence is a report gap. Sometimes it's the center refusing to pre-commit. Reading Chinese industrial documents is mostly the work of telling those two apart.

Why consolidation is bullish for a few and fatal for most

Shift from policy to flow, because that's where the tradeable signal sits.

If 2030 NEV penetration lands at 70% of passenger sales plus 40% of commercial, China's annual NEV volume runs into the 18–22 million unit range. That's the demand side. The supply side is where the plan draws blood: fewer producers, higher concentration, and a stated ambition to seat Chinese names inside the global top ten by volume and the global top hundred by parts revenue.

Two winners emerge. The vertically integrated giants — BYD is the template, self-supplying batteries, semiconductors, and much of its own component base — win on scale economics. And the focused component champions — CATL-style horizontal specialists — win on global supply relationships. The plan rewards both paths at once, which is why you'll eventually see integrated groups hatching specialized subsidiaries to satisfy the parts KPI. The two targets aren't in tension. They're a division of labor.

The losers are obvious once you say them out loud: second and third-tier automakers with no technical moat, Tier-1 and Tier-2 suppliers with commodity parts and no pricing power, and any producer whose only edge was a local government that won't protect it anymore.

Where does blockchain actually enter the picture, beyond analogy? Three concrete places.

First, the assets being created are tokenizable. Battery passports, charging-station revenue, and EV fleet financing are all real-world-asset classes waiting for a compliant wrapper. The European battery regulation is already forcing digital battery passports into existence — a physical asset with a cryptographic provenance record. That is an RWA primitive sitting inside an industrial policy, and the crypto media missed it. Security is a feature, not a marketing slide — and so, it turns out, is a battery passport. They're built the same way: provenance, attestation, and an unforgeable chain of custody.

Second, the standard-setting clause. The plan commits China to strengthening its voice in international standards by 2030, right after claiming leadership on the first global self-driving regulation. That's an export-control instrument dressed as technical diplomacy. Whoever writes the standard owns the compliance cost. It's the same dynamic as token standards: the team that writes the standard taxes everyone who builds against it. China is trying to move from rule-taker to rule-writer, and the parallel — where standard authors capture the ecosystem — should make the intent legible to anyone who's watched token standard proliferation.

Third, the carbon market link. China's national emissions trading scheme hasn't yet folded in autos, so the direct pressure is limited. The real lever is the dual-credit regime — fuel-economy credits plus NEV credits — and this plan's efficiency targets are really an intensification of that tool. For export-facing players, green power sourcing becomes a compliance line item the moment CBAM bites.
